i have a question... if a mobile game data that you can access with asset studio suddenly cant be accessed with asset studio, does it mean the game file is encrypted somehow? and is there way to find the encryption method of the data by comparing 2 datas of same contents but different time?

Re: question about encrypted game data

Posted: Fri Sep 24, 2021 10:29 pm
by ikskoks
It can be encrypted as you said, but it can also mean that whole game engine has been updated and version of the assets has changed as well.
